Fire Safety in Industrial Facilities: Features and Requirements of Safety Systems

This article discusses the fire safety threats in industrial facilities and the measures to mitigate them. The main fire safety threats identified in the article include electrical systems, technological processes, heat sources, combustible and explosive materials, non-compliance with fire safety regulations, mechanical damage, and natural disasters. The article also emphasizes the requirements for fire extinguishing systems in industrial facilities, the importance of using modern technologies, and the necessity of training employees. It highlights the advantages and necessity of using fire extinguishing systems with automation. As a result, the article emphasizes the importance of properly selected, installed, and regularly maintained fire extinguishing systems to minimize fire risks and ensure safety in industrial facilities.
